Ep. 44 Liberating Yourself from Inherited Beliefs: Rethinking Your Relationship With Suffering


Listen Later

In this empowering episode, we embark on a journey of self-discovery and liberation from the inherited burdens of suffering. Together, we explore how parenting profoundly influences our pain perception and unveil the critical importance of questioning and challenging these beliefs.

Join us as we shed light on the profound impact parents have on shaping our relationship with suffering. Through insightful discussions, we empower you to adopt a more critical lens toward parental influences and recognize their significant impact on our well-being.

By the end of this episode, you will be inspired to embrace the truth that suffering is not your birthright. You will gain the confidence to demand more from your parents and nurture the understanding that liberation from inherited suffering is your inherent right.
